Status: Lost

Crash Bandicoot & Spyro Adventure World was a promotion with Nabisco in 2004 on candystand.com. Tied in with Crash Bandicoot Purple: Ripto's Rampage and Spyro Orange: The Cortex Conspiracy on the Game Boy Advance, in specially marked packages of Nabisco products, there'd be Crash Bandicoot or Spyro themed cards. The cards contained codes that unlocked new minigames on the site. These include:

  • Crash's Nitro Kart Rally
  • Crash's Rocketmania
  • Smack-A-Dingo
  • Raygun Alley
  • Spyro's Flying Adventure
  • Binky's Cavernous Caverns
  • Hunter's Target Range

None of Adventure World's files remain on the site.
